Battles remixed by The Field, Shabbazz Palaces, Kode9, Gang Gang Dance and Hudson Mohawke for ‘Gloss Drop’ redux
The tracklisting for Battles’ ‘Dross Glop’ has been announced. Remixing tracks from the mathrock band’s slightly disappointing second full album are The Alchemist, Kode9, Shazz Palaces, The Field, Gui Boratto, Silent Servant, Kangding Ray, Patrick Mahoney & Dennis McNany, Qluster, Brian DeGraw of Gang Gang Dance, Hudson Mohawke and Eye of The Boredoms. They have very cutely made a playlist of every person who has remixed a track on the album, and you can play it below. Released across four 12“s, the CD will be out on April 16th on Warp.

Mosca and Julio Bashmore open show on Radio 1
Two of the recent bass explosion’s most compelling DJ-producers, Mosca and Julio Bashmore have both been given shows on The Nation’s favourite. In New DJs We Trust, a weekly programme showcasing new DJs, unsurprisingly, goes out every Thursday evening from 9-10, and the sign that two such talented producers are getting this level of exposure is part of a wider shake-up of Radio 1’s coverage of electronic music.

The day’s festival headliners headlines
Speaking of Mosca, he’ll be playing along side Kuedo, Appleblim and DJ Rashad at the Glade Festival, which takes place on June 14-17 at Houghton Hall, Norfolk.

Iceage, Kwes, Spector, Brandt Brauer Frick and Pariah are among the people playing the Camden Crawl, which takes place in London’s you-guessed-it on the 4th, 5th and 6th May.

Nicolas Jaar, Surgeon and Monolake have been added to the Bloc Weekend bill. Other names include DOOM, Battles, Orbital and FlyLo, and the festival takes place 6-7th July, in east London.

Etiene De Crecy has a huge retrospective on the way
The French house producer will be putting out a 5-CD best-of in April. One CD of studio productions, two of remixes and two of unreleased rarities from Etienne De Crecy will be out on the 6th April, and you can preview these over etiennedecrecy.fr.
